Significant effectiveness liquid chromatography is essentially a hugely improved form of column chromatography. Rather than a solvent becoming permitted to drip through a column below gravity, it's compelled by underneath substantial pressures of around 400 atmospheres. Which makes it considerably quicker.

From all chromatography techniques, liquid chromatography (LC) is commonly utilized across unique industries. This is a separation technique in which the mobile stage is often a liquid, wherever sample ions or molecules are dissolved. It can be completed both in a column or maybe a aircraft. HPLC is an advanced and modified LC technique executed less than a significantly bigger operational stress than LC.
